Toggle navigation
Patchwork
Patches credited to richard.henderson@linaro.org
Login
Register
Mail settings
Current Team Memberships
team-tcwg
Show patches with
: State =
Action Required
| Archived =
No
| 5546 patches
Series
Submitter
State
any
Action Required
New
Under Review
Accepted
Rejected
RFC
Not Applicable
Changes Requested
Awaiting Upstream
Superseded
Deferred
Search
Archived
No
Yes
Both
Apply
«
1
2
...
15
16
17
…
55
56
»
▾
Patch
Series
S/W/F
Date
Submitter
Delegate
State
[v4.5,07/29] includes: move tb_flush into its own header
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,06/29] gdbstub: move GDBState to shared internals header
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,05/29] gdbstub: define separate user/system structures
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,04/29] gdbstub: clean-up indent on gdb_exit
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,03/29] gdbstub: Make syscall_complete/[gs]et_reg target-agnostic typedefs
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,02/29] gdbstub: fix-up copyright and license files
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[v4.5,01/29] gdbstub/internals.h: clean up include guard
gdbstub/next: re-organise and split build
-
-
-
2023-03-03
Richard Henderson
New
[PULL,v2,00/62] tcg patch queue
-
-
-
2023-03-01
Richard Henderson
New
[PULL,62/62] tcg: Update docs/devel/tcg-ops.rst for temporary changes
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,57/62] target/mips: Don't use tcg_temp_local_new
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,55/62] target/hppa: Don't use tcg_temp_local_new
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,53/62] target/hexagon: Don't use tcg_temp_local_new_*
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,50/62] target/arm: Drop copies in gen_sve_{ldr,str}
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,33/62] accel/tcg: Pass max_insn to gen_intermediate_code by pointer
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,32/62] tcg: Adjust TCGContext.temps_in_use check
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,28/62] target/hexagon: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,21/62] target/riscv: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,20/62] target/rx: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,18/62] target/sparc: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,17/62] target/tricore: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,16/62] accel/tcg: Replace `tb_pc()` with `tb->pc`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,15/62] accel/tcg: Move jmp-cache `CF_PCREL` checks to caller
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,10/62] target/arm: Replace `TARGET_TB_PCREL` with `CF_PCREL`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,08/62] accel/tcg: Replace `TARGET_TB_PCREL` with `CF_PCREL`
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,04/62] accel/tcg: Add 'size' param to probe_access_full
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,03/62] accel/tcg: Add 'size' param to probe_access_flags()
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
[PULL,01/62] exec/helper-head: Include missing "fpu/softfloat-types.h" header
-
-
-
2023-03-01
Richard Henderson
New
[PULL,00/62] tcg patch queue
-
-
-
2023-03-01
Richard Henderson
New
[1/2] tcg: Clear plugin_mem_cbs on TB exit
plugin: fix clearing of plugin_mem_cbs on TB exit
-
-
-
2023-03-01
Richard Henderson
New
[for-8.0,v4,21/21] NOTFORMERGE hw/arm/virt: Add some memory for Realm Management Monitor
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[for-8.0,v4,20/21] NOTFORMERGE target/arm: Enable RME for -cpu max
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[for-8.0,v4,14/21] target/arm: Use get_phys_addr_with_struct in S1_ptw_translate
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[for-8.0,v4,12/21] target/arm: Handle Block and Page bits for security space
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[for-8.0,v4,10/21] target/arm: Pipe ARMSecuritySpace through ptw.c
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[for-8.0,v4,08/21] target/arm: Introduce ARMMMUIdx_Phys_{Realm, Root}
target/arm: Implement FEAT_RME
-
-
-
2023-02-27
Richard Henderson
New
[v3,13/14] target/arm: Export arm_v7m_get_sp_ptr
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v3,12/14] target/arm: Export arm_v7m_mrs_control
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v3,11/14] target/arm: Implement gdbstub pauth extension
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v3,04/14] target/arm: Split out output_vector_union_type
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v3,03/14] target/arm: Move arm_gen_dynamic_svereg_xml to gdbstub64.c
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v3,01/14] target/arm: Normalize aarch64 gdbstub get/set function names
target/arm: gdbstub cleanups and additions
-
-
-
2023-02-27
Richard Henderson
New
[v4,13/31] tcg: Use tcg_temp_ebb_new_* in tcg/
tcg: Simplify temporary usage
-
-
-
2023-02-27
Richard Henderson
New
[v2,56/76] target/s390x: Use tcg_constant_* for DisasCompare
tcg: Drop tcg_temp_free from translators
-
-
-
2023-02-27
Richard Henderson
New
[v2,55/76] target/s390x: Use tcg_constant_* in local contexts
tcg: Drop tcg_temp_free from translators
-
-
-
2023-02-27
Richard Henderson
New
[v2,53/76] target/riscv: Drop tcg_temp_free
tcg: Drop tcg_temp_free from translators
-
-
-
2023-02-27
Richard Henderson
New
[74/76] tracing: remove transform.py
tcg: Drop tcg_temp_free from translators
-
-
-
2023-02-25
Richard Henderson
New
[27/76] target/hexagon/idef-parser: Drop tcg_temp_free
tcg: Drop tcg_temp_free from translators
-
-
-
2023-02-25
Richard Henderson
New
accel/tcg: Add 'size' param to probe_access_full
accel/tcg: Add 'size' param to probe_access_full
-
-
-
2023-02-24
Richard Henderson
New
[11/13] accel/tcg: Add TLB_CHECK_ALIGNED
{tcg,aarch64}: Add TLB_CHECK_ALIGNED
-
-
-
2023-02-23
Richard Henderson
New
[07/13] accel/tcg: Move TLB_WATCHPOINT to TLB_SLOW_FLAGS_MASK
{tcg,aarch64}: Add TLB_CHECK_ALIGNED
-
-
-
2023-02-23
Richard Henderson
New
[v2,28/28] tcg: Use noinline for major tcg_gen_code_subroutines
tcg: Simplify temporary usage
-
-
-
2023-02-22
Richard Henderson
New
[v2,27/28] tcg: Update docs/devel/tcg-ops.rst for temporary changes
tcg: Simplify temporary usage
-
-
-
2023-02-22
Richard Henderson
New
[PULL,v2,6/8] target/microblaze: Add gdbstub xml
[PULL,v2,1/8] accel/tcg: Allow the second page of an instruction to be MMIO
-
-
-
2023-02-22
Richard Henderson
New
[PULL,v2,4/8] cpus: Make {start,end}_exclusive() recursive
[PULL,v2,1/8] accel/tcg: Allow the second page of an instruction to be MMIO
-
-
-
2023-02-22
Richard Henderson
New
[PULL,v2,0/8] tcg patch queue
-
-
-
2023-02-22
Richard Henderson
New
[2/2] target/arm: Fix arm_cpu_get_phys_page_attrs_debug for m-profile
target/arm: Fix gdbstub for m-profile (#1421)
-
-
-
2023-02-21
Richard Henderson
New
[1/2] Revert "target/arm: Merge regime_is_secure into get_phys_addr"
target/arm: Fix gdbstub for m-profile (#1421)
-
-
-
2023-02-21
Richard Henderson
New
[v2,19/21] target/arm: Implement the granule protection check
target/arm: Implement FEAT_RME
-
-
-
2023-02-20
Richard Henderson
New
[v2,15/21] target/arm: Move s1_is_el0 into S1Translate
target/arm: Implement FEAT_RME
-
-
-
2023-02-20
Richard Henderson
New
[v4,27/27] target/s390x: Enable TARGET_TB_PCREL
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,26/27] target/s390x: Pass original r2 register to BCR
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,25/27] tests/tcg/s390x: Add per.S
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,24/27] target/s390x: Fix successful-branch PER events
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,23/27] target/s390x: Remove PER check from use_goto_tb
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,22/27] target/s390x: Split per_breaking_event from per_branch_*
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,21/27] target/s390x: Simplify help_branch
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,20/27] target/s390x: Split per_branch
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,17/27] target/s390x: Introduce per_enabled
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,16/27] target/s390x: Don't set gbea for user-only
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,15/27] target/s390x: Add disp argument to update_psw_addr
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,14/27] target/s390x: Assert masking of psw.addr in cpu_get_tb_cpu_state
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,13/27] target/s390x: Use ilen instead in branches
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,09/27] target/s390x: Remove pc argument to pc_to_link_into
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,08/27] target/s390x: Introduce gen_psw_addr_disp
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,07/27] target/s390x: Change help_goto_direct to work on displacements
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,06/27] tests/tcg/s390x: Add sam.S
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[v4,05/27] tests/tcg/s390x: Add bal.S
target/s390x: pc-relative translation blocks
-
-
-
2023-02-20
Richard Henderson
New
[PULL,7/7] target/microblaze: Add gdbstub xml
[PULL,1/7] accel/tcg: Allow the second page of an instruction to be MMIO
-
-
-
2023-02-20
Richard Henderson
New
[PULL,6/7] tests/tcg/linux-test: Add linux-fork-trap test
[PULL,1/7] accel/tcg: Allow the second page of an instruction to be MMIO
-
-
-
2023-02-20
Richard Henderson
New
[PULL,0/7] tcg patch queue
-
-
-
2023-02-20
Richard Henderson
New
[v2,15/15] linux-user/sparc: Handle tag overflow traps
linux-user/sparc: Handle missing traps
-
-
-
2023-02-16
Richard Henderson
New
[v2,14/15] linux-user/sparc: Handle floating-point exceptions
linux-user/sparc: Handle missing traps
-
-
-
2023-02-16
Richard Henderson
New
[v2,06/15] linux-user/sparc: Fix sparc64_{get, set}_context traps
linux-user/sparc: Handle missing traps
-
-
-
2023-02-16
Richard Henderson
New
[v1,16/19] target/arm: Relax ordered/atomic alignment checks for LSE2
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,14/19] target/arm: Check alignment in helper_mte_check
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,13/19] target/arm: Pass single_memop to gen_mte_checkN
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,12/19] target/arm: Pass memop to gen_mte_check1*
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,11/19] target/arm: Hoist finalize_memop out of do_fp_{ld, st}
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,09/19] target/arm: Load/store integer pair with one tcg operation
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,08/19] target/arm: Add atom_data to DisasContext
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,06/19] target/arm: Sink gen_mte_check1 into load/store_exclusive
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,05/19] target/arm: Use tcg_gen_qemu_{ld, st}_i128 in gen_sve_{ld, st}r
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,04/19] target/arm: Use tcg_gen_qemu_st_i128 for STZG, STZ2G
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,03/19] target/arm: Use tcg_gen_qemu_{st, ld}_i128 for do_fp_{st, ld}
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,02/19] target/arm: Use tcg_gen_qemu_ld_i128 for LDXP
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v1,01/19] target/arm: Make cpu_exclusive_high hold the high bits
target/arm: Implement FEAT_LSE2
-
-
-
2023-02-16
Richard Henderson
New
[v2,30/30] tcg/i386: Honor 64-bit atomicity in 32-bit mode
tcg: Improve atomicity support
-
-
-
2023-02-16
Richard Henderson
New
[v2,29/30] tcg/i386: Add vex_v argument to tcg_out_vex_modrm_pool
tcg: Improve atomicity support
-
-
-
2023-02-16
Richard Henderson
New
[v2,28/30] tcg/i386: Support 128-bit load/store with have_atomic16
tcg: Improve atomicity support
-
-
-
2023-02-16
Richard Henderson
New
[v2,27/30] tcg/i386: Examine MemOp for atomicity and alignment
tcg: Improve atomicity support
-
-
-
2023-02-16
Richard Henderson
New
«
1
2
...
15
16
17
…
55
56
»
Bundling
Create bundle: